Considering the recent issues with infinikey's consistency, it's rather disappointing to see this set go from the golden standard of consistency (GMK), then to a mid-ground of quality and consistency (ePBT), to where it is now. If this was going through ePBT I was probably going to be onboard after pricing, even though I'd likely prefer GMK above all. For now though, this is a pass due to the manufacturer. All signs seem to point to this being a middle of the road manu, and with their new prices getting near that of ePBT, I will be undoubtedly passing for that reason. If you could get this back to a more reliable/consistent manufacturer, I'd be interested again.

From what I have seen with other sets Epbt had a lot of issues getting reverse dye sub right and are reluctant to take on sets with a ton of it involved. Infinikey on the other hand is attempting reverse dye sub on the regular and is going to improve as sets get run through. Personally, I would rather see this attempted in PBT than see another set go GMK. ABS is meh and GMK prices are insane. No one should have to pay $40+ for a freaking numpad, much less an UK iso set.
